Ticket: Staging env misconfigured for Siftgate bloom filter

The bloom layer in front of the Pellet KV store is rejecting all lookups in staging because the env file was copied from the dev template without credentials. False-positive tuning values are fine; only the auth line is missing. To unblock the weekly demo, the Pellet admission secret must be set on the following line.

env line for yaguf-fajop: LEDGER_TOKEN13=fb08984397349

Subject: Bakery cutoff logic handover

Hi Marlow,

Welcome to the Crumbport project! The order-cutoff rule is simple: custom cake orders lock at 2pm two days ahead, enforced by a trigger on `orders`. Holiday overrides sit in `cutoff_exceptions` — check there first when someone claims a rejected order is a bug. You can reach the orders database with the connection string below.

database URL for bagap-yahap: mysql://druax_svc:s0i8rHw@db-fdc1.orvexworks.local:5432/druius

Budget Request: Project Lanternwell (Managers-Only Wiki)

Quick summary for the board: we're asking for an uplift of roughly 12 percent to get Lanternwell's analytics build over the line. Most of it covers contractor time and the Fennimore test rig; the rest is a modest buffer. Without it, we slip past the spring window and lose the Harwick pilot. Full cost sheet is attached on this page. The sensitive commercial context is noted just below.

internal memo for yahag-hahig: Belwynix Group plans to lower the Silir list price by 62 percent in May.

## Proctor Queue — Vigilum

Each exam session enqueues a proctor-assignment job. Workers claim jobs with a visibility timeout; expired claims requeue automatically. Review any change to retry counts carefully — duplicate assignments page the on-call. Dead-lettered jobs go to manual triage. The reviewer should verify diffs against the current production settings, which are listed below.

config for kafof-bawef:
holath:
  log_level: debug
  metrics_host: metrics.holath.qorvelsys.internal
  pin: 2191
  pool_size: 32